Structured Query Language est la norme American National Standards Institute pour manipuler des données dans une base de données . Prononcé « ess- que- el , " les commandes de base du langage peut être utilisé sur la plupart des bases de données , y compris MS Access , SQL Server, Oracle et Sybase.SQL permet la récupération d'informations à partir d'une base de données pour répondre à des questions ou des requêtes complexes. Structured Query Language est également utilisé pour créer la base de données . Relational Database Systems
Une base de données est constituée de tables , chacune avec un nom unique. Une collection de tables dans la base de données est une relation. Commandes SQL manipuler l'information dans une base de données afin que les dossiers peuvent être récupérés à partir de plusieurs tables et combinées dans une tête de colonne report.Each de la table définit le nom de la colonne , les attributs de colonnes et le type de données. Les lignes du tableau contiennent les données , ou records.Even si SQL est le langage standard ANSI pour la gestion de base de données , il existe plusieurs versions de SQL propriétaires de la société qui a créé le système de gestion. Par exemple, lors de l'exécution de plusieurs instructions SQL à un moment donné , certains systèmes de bases de données nécessitent le placement d'un point-virgule ( ;) après chaque instruction , tandis que d'autres ne le font pas . Quelques commandes SQL simples peuvent vous permettre de manipuler une base de données .
SQL Data Manipulation Language
DML , ou Data Manipulation Language , les commandes SQL qui sont utilisés pour interroger et mettre à jour les commandes base de données.Les SELECT, UPDATE , DELETE et INSERT INTO sont DML .
SQL Data Definition Language
DDL, ou Data Definition Language . inclure les commandes SQL qui sont utilisés pour créer , définir , supprimer et lier les informations dans les tables de la base de données.Les déclarations les plus importantes dans DDL sont celles qui vont créer ou modifier la base de données , créer, modifier ou supprimer une table , ou créer ou supprimer un index ( clé de recherche ) . Ces commandes sont CREATE DATABASE , ALTER DATABASE, CREATE TABLE , ALTER TABLE, DROP TABLE , CREATE iNDEX et DROP INDEX.
plus utilisés commandes SQL
Photos
Beaucoup de systèmes de bases de données les plus courantes viennent avec leurs propres cloches et de sifflets propriétaires à rendre leurs systèmes faciles à utiliser. Ces entreprises intègrent leurs propres dialectes SQL qui fonctionnent uniquement avec des commandes spécifiques que les bases de données SQL system.Six de base , cependant, peut permettre à un utilisateur de faire n'importe quoi avec n'importe quelle base de données, si l'auto créé ou partie d'un system.The de gestion de base de données plus achetés les commandes SQL utilisées sont SELECT, DELETE , DROP , créer, INSERT et UPDATE . • l'instruction SELECT spécifie les critères devant être extraits de la base de données. • Supprimer permet de supprimer des lignes ou des dossiers spécifiques à partir des tables . • ; DROP supprime toutes les lignes de la table, et la table elle-même • Créer est utilisé pour créer une nouvelle base de données , une table ou un index • INSERT va ajouter une ligne de données , ou un dossier . . à une table. • Mettre à jour les enregistrements de modifications qui correspondent aux critères sélectionnés.
tables
tables de base de données peut avoir autant de colonnes que nécessaire. Ces colonnes peuvent être formatés en type de données autorisé et une contrainte peut être appliquée si vous le souhaitez . Une contrainte est une règle que les données saisies doivent suivre.